Matter of City of Yonkers

Court of Appeals of the State of New York
Jun 13, 1933
188 N.E. 58 (N.Y. 1933)

Opinion

Argued May 25, 1933

Decided June 13, 1933

Appeal from the Supreme Court, Appellate Division, Second Department.

Leonard G. McAneny, Corporation Counsel ( J. Raymond Hannon and Morris L. Rosenwasser of counsel), for appellant.

William A. Walsh and Joseph J. McCann for Louis A. Van Dyk et al., respondents.

William J. Wallin, Charles J. Tobin and Richard Edie, 3rd, for M.E.D. Corporation et al., respondents.

John A. Wallace for Wilfred F. Fuller et al., respondents.


Appeal dismissed, with costs, on the ground that the appeal does not lie as matter of right. ( Nod-Away Co. v. Carroll, 240 N.Y. 252, 253.) No opinion.

Concur: POUND, Ch. J., CRANE, LEHMAN, KELLOGG, O'BRIEN and CROUCH, JJ. Not sitting: HUBBS, J.
